In case you were wondering how that neat-looking Steelbook release of Arcane Season One did in sales — because it’s never a guarantee how well these things will do no matter how neat they look — it must have done well enough. GKIDS, who licensed and distributed the first season on Blu-Ray and 4K Blu-Ray last year, just announced they’ve extended the rights to publish Season 2 as well.
The deal covers worldwide rights. excluding China, to both seasons of the series, and allows GKIDS to produce and distribute said content in physical format across all regions. Since Netflix did not stream Arcane in 4K, this version will be exclusive to home video.
“The GKIDS team is absolutely thrilled to continue its partnership with Riot and Fortiche,” said GKIDS Director of Home Entertainment Alison Kozberg. “From the beginning, we developed our season one 4KUHD and Blu-ray editions with an eye towards eventually celebrating the whole story of Jinx, Vi, Piltover and Zaun. We couldn’t be more excited to create something really special for the arc’s momentous conclusion.”
Arcane, which was always planned to be two seasons long, was about a class war between two communities, the ritzy city of Piltover and the gritty city of Zaun beneath it, with the central POVs coming from two sisters of differing pastel hair color. Its overlords at Riot, who also create the League of Legends games the series is based on, have more adaptions planned from the same world (and have not ruled out the possibility of characters that appeared in Arcane appearing again later).
Arcane’s latest season took the Annie Awards by storm earlier this month, winning all seven categories it was nominated in including Best FX (TV), Best Character Animation (TV), Best Direction (TV), Best Music (TV), Best Production Design (TV), Best Storyboarding (TV), and Best Editorial (TV). It couldn’t win Best TV Series because, oddly, it didn’t have a nomination there.
Exact details, like what the Arcane Season 2 Blu will look like or what special features it will contain, have yet to be determined. We will probably learn more in the coming months. Traditionally products like these target a late-year holiday release.
